For the undersuit, Are you a member of Costco? There are two pack of 32Degrees shirts and pants that I use. Very comfortable and only $12-$15 for a two pack. Neck seals can be from Darman's Props or Geeky Pinks. Are you a member of Whitearmor.net yet? That is your first stop.

Hey William welcome back and aboard. I can quickly answer some of your questions. Jedi robes is not a good option. For armor contact Walt and company at WTF (Walt's Trooper Factory) does a decent enough kit depending on your size. Boots are a bit easier for the shadow trooper. Any Chelsea or jodhpur boot will be acceptable. But if you want specific types there's Imperial Boots, not sure if they're doing a run now, and CrowProps.
Undershirt and all of that are easy as well any plain black compression gear or even long John type of underwear is good there.
